The Wild North (1952)
Film The Wild North by director Andrew Marton with cinematographer Robert Surtees and writer Frank Fenton.
Starring in The Wild North from 1952 is Stewart Granger, Cyd Charisse and Wendell Corey, among others.
Details
- Title: The Wild North
- Year: 1952
- Duration: 97 minutes (1h 37m)
The Wild North Crew
The main crew of The Wild North consists of:
- Director: Andrew Marton
- Cinematographer: Robert Surtees
- Writer: Frank Fenton
The Wild North Cast
The main cast of The Wild North consists of Stewart Granger as Jules Vincent, Cyd Charisse as Indian girl and Wendell Corey as Constable Pedley.
